The Project Manager is responsible for ensuring projects are completed on time, within budget, and to high standards of quality and safety. Serving as a key liaison between the field, office, subcontractors, vendors, and clients, this role involves managing project schedules, enforcing quality control, resolving on-site issues, and maintaining strong communication across all stakeholders. Success in this position requires a proactive leader who can problem-solve in real time, oversee multiple projects, and drive outcomes that reflect a commitment to excellence and client satisfaction. Must have commercial general contractor industry experience. Roles and Responsibilities Quality Control --Ensure all construction components meet high standards of quality. --Manage and enforce project-specific quality control checklists. --Oversee and promote job site safety in accordance with OSHA standards and internal policies. Scheduling and Ordering --Manage schedules, material submittals, delivery dates, and crew deployment. --Track all stages of construction using Buildertrend project management software. --Develop and coordinate detailed subcontractor work schedules. --Collaborate with the Estimator to process and document change orders. --Submit receipts and invoices on time. Project Coordination --Assist with project startup tasks, including permit applications and initial coordination meetings. --Support job site activities by issuing RFIs, change orders, and work authorizations. --Participate in site meetings and coordinate field activities with the Superintendent. --Manage permit timelines, CO inspections, and final close-out documentation. --Perform final walkthroughs and oversee punch list completion. Subcontractor and Vendor Relationships --Evaluate, select, and onboard subcontractors and vendors as needed. --Hold subcontractors accountable for performing work in accordance with local building codes and manufacturer specifications. --Oversee execution and adherence to Statements of Work (SOWs). Management --Lead weekly on-site team and project coordination meetings. --Oversee allocation and delivery of construction resources. --Address high-level site issues such as theft, waste, and material mismanagement. --Serve as the point of escalation for resolving project or personnel conflicts. Communication with Stakeholders --Respond to stakeholder inquiries within 24 hours. --Communicate schedule updates and delays promptly, especially those impacting completion dates. Additional Responsibilities --Perform final project walkthroughs and punch list completion. --Participate in post-project review and lessons learned sessions. --Assist with permitting and inspection coordination as needed. --Update project documentation in a timely and accurate manner in Buildertrend. Accountabilities &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) These accountabilities represent the core responsibilities expected to be performed efficiently and effectively. KPIs are used to measure performance in these areas. --Job Cost Projects completed within or under budget --Schedule Milestones met on schedule; minimal delays ( --Safety & Quality Compliance with codes, specs, safety standards; low incident rate (0 lost time incidents) --Site Visits Minimum 1 visit per site, per week Qualifications --7-10+ years of proven, diverse construction project management experience --Self-starter with proactive problem-solving skills. --Strong organizational, analytical, and communication abilities. --Knowledge of current building codes. --Completion of ABC Project Management course (preferred). --OSHA 30-hour Safety Training (preferred). --Experience using Buildertrend (preferred). --Valid driver’s license and clean driving record. Physical Demands and Work Environment --Frequent standing, walking, climbing ladders, and navigating active job sites. --Occasional lifting of materials up to 50 pounds. --Exposure to outdoor weather conditions and construction environments.
